AbstractIn this paper, we present an over-the-air (OTA) performance analysis of Grassmannian signaling strategies in an orthogonal frequencydivision multiplexing (OFDM) single-user multiple-input multiple-output (SU-MIMO) scenario. Speci cally, we compare the Grassmannian signaling technique to the di erential Alamouti scheme and a novel space-time non-coherent scheme recently proposed in the context of 5G. As a performance benchmark we include in the comparison the coherent Alamouti scheme. We study the practical impairments associated to frequency synchronization mismatches (frequency o sets), as well as the e ects of time-varying channels for di erent spectral eciencies. The experimental results show that non-coherent techniques are more robust to the aforementioned impairments than the coherent Alamouti approach, while Grassmannian methods are close to the di erential Alamouti scheme with 2 transmit antennas.
